1. Уважаемые пользователи, прежде чем ответить в теме или создать новую,
    внимательно ознакомьтесь с правилами раздела

    Кому лень работать или руки не оттуда - пользуйтесь услугами специалистов
  2. Не задавайте глупых вопросов "Посоветуйте какой-нибудь компонент.."

    Есть JED!!! Ищите там!!!

В розыске такой модуль или может кто починит его

Тема в разделе "Joomla", создана пользователем DK-Scorp, 9 май 2009.

Информация :
  • Уважаемые пользователи, прежде чем ответить в теме или создать новую, внимательно ознакомьтесь с правилами раздела
  • Не задавайте глупых вопросов "Посоветуйте какой-нибудь компонент.." Есть JED!!! Ищите там!!!
  • Аналоги ищите там же - на JED!!!
  • Новая версия? - У кого будет - тот выложит!
Статус темы:
Закрыта.
Модераторы: arman29, DMS, Genk0
  1. DK-Scorp

    DK-Scorp Постоялец

    Регистр.:
    30 ноя 2006
    Сообщения:
    109
    Симпатии:
    7
    Ищу модуль оправки материала юзерами с фронта в модуле, нашел вот этот, но работает через раз - непонятно как (то отправит, то нет) и псоле отправки "впадает в белый экран". Может есть что-то подобное или у кого нить руки заточены (я в пхп не силен:(). Автор модуля не реагирует и вообще перешел на WP. Joomla - 1.0.15.
     

    Вложения:

  2. DK-Scorp

    DK-Scorp Постоялец

    Регистр.:
    30 ноя 2006
    Сообщения:
    109
    Симпатии:
    7
    вообщем нашел глюк в нем, при выборе нескольких категорий он отправляет, причем только в первую указанную в настройках, мне требуется отпралвять только в одну категорию, там стоит проверка на количество категорий:
    В оригинале :
    <?php if (count($cats_id) != 1) { ?>
    <label class="chd_title<?php $params->get('moduleclass_sfx') ; ?>">Выбор категории (*:(</label><br />
    <select class="chd_select<?php $params->get('moduleclass_sfx') ; ?>" name="catid">
    <option value="NA">Выберите категорию...</option>' ;
    <?php $database->setQuery("SELECT id, name FROM #__categories");
    $cats = $database->loadObjectList();
    foreach($cats as $c){
    if (in_array($c->id,$cats_id)) {
    echo '<option value="'.$c->id.'">';
    echo $c->name ;
    echo '</option>';
    }
    }
    ?>
    </select><br /><br />
    <?php
    }
    ?>

    Я ее убрал, т.е. по умолчанию ставится имя категории (одной в моем случае, что мне и требуется)

    <label class="chd_title<?php $params->get('moduleclass_sfx') ; ?>">Выбор категории (*:(</label><br />
    <select class="chd_select<?php $params->get('moduleclass_sfx') ; ?>" name="catid">
    <?php $database->setQuery("SELECT id, name FROM #__categories");
    $cats = $database->loadObjectList();
    foreach($cats as $c){
    if (in_array($c->id,$cats_id)) {
    echo '<option value="'.$c->id.'">';
    echo $c->name ;
    echo '</option>';
    }
    }
    ?>
    </select><br /><br />

    Вопрос - как убрать этот селект, и по умолчанию присвоить значение ID категории.

    Уважаемые админы - извиняюсь если не в тот топик, но другого не нашел, не в варезе же постить и вроде как не совсем к чистому PHP относится, joomla есть все-таки, и вопрос горящий.
     
Статус темы:
Закрыта.